The man is just amazing. Coach Belichick wins Coach of the Year. He also won the award in 2003.
The Patriots were on an amazing run this year going undefeated and all. They also racked up the points and personal records.
Tom Brady had a great year passing for more touchdowns than anyone in any season, including the exalted Peyton Manning.
Randy Moss caught more touchdown passes in one season than anyone in NFL history, including the exalted Jerry Rice.
It isn’t just that, the Patriots have been the top franchise for several years in a league of parity created by a very restrictive salary cap. Belichick has a hand in all personnel decisions.
All the stars lined up and Coach Belichick wins!
With the Patriots motivated by a spying scandal — and owning the deepest talent base in football — Belichick guided his team to the first 16-0 regular season in league history.
That was enough to offset the major blemish on Belichick’s resume: a $500,000 personal fine, $250,000 fine for the team and the loss of a first-round pick in the upcoming draft after the Patriots were caught videotaping New York Jets coaches during the season opener. source
